Windows 11 PCで別のオペレーティングシステムを簡単に実行する方法

Windows 11マシンで別のOSを動かしたいと思ったことはありませんか?もちろん、Windowsは完璧ではないので、テストしたり、レガシーアプリを実行したり、メインドライブに直接インストールせずに他のプラットフォームを試したりする必要がある場合もあります。しかし、デュアルブートの設定は面倒で、ディスクをパーティション分割したり、システムを壊してしまうリスクを負うことに抵抗がある人もいるでしょう。そこで仮想化の出番です。仮想化は、いわば安全なサンドボックスのようなもので、メインのWindowsに影響を与えることなく、ウィンドウ内でフルOSを起動できます。いつものやり方に飽き飽きしている方は、以下の手順で設定方法をご確認ください。

Windows 11 コンピューターで別のオペレーティングシステムを実行する方法

Windows 11で別のOSを動かすのは、それほど難しいことではありませんが、決して簡単ではありません。少なくとも、ある程度の準備は必要です。Linux、以前のバージョンのWindows、あるいはmacOS(ハードウェアが対応している場合)を試してみたい場合でも、仮想化を活用すれば簡単です。ただし、PCには十分なスペックが必要です。少なくとも8GBのRAM、BIOSで仮想化サポートが有効になっているマルチコアCPU、そして十分なストレージ容量が必要です。そしてもちろん、ISOファイルは信頼できるソースから入手してください。さて、セットアップの話はここまでにして、実際の手順に入りましょう。

仮想化ソフトウェアを選ぶ

ここからすべてが始まります。予算と快適さに応じて選択してください。VirtualBox は無料のオープンソースで、ほとんどのカジュアルユーザーにとっては定番の選択肢です。VMware は機能が豊富ですが有効ですが有料なので、本格的にテストするのでなければ過剰かもしれません。Hyper-V は Windows 11 Pro 以上に組み込まれていますが、誰もがそのバージョンを使用しているわけではありません。まだアクティブになっていない場合は、 [設定] > [アプリ] > [オプション機能] > [機能の追加] > [Hyper-V]で有効にする必要があります。セットアップによっては、Hyper-V が VirtualBox または VMware と競合する可能性があるので、慎重に選択してください。Hyper-V のセットアップは少し面倒ですが、一度完了するとかなり信頼できます。BIOS で CPU の仮想化サポート (Intel VT-x や AMD-V など) を確認してください。デフォルトでオフになっている場合もあります。

選択したOSのISOファイルをダウンロードする

試してみたいOSのISOイメージを入手しましょう。Linuxなら、UbuntuやFedoraなどのディストリビューションは簡単です。Windowsなら、Microsoftの公式サイトから最新のISOイメージを入手できます。MacOSの場合は少し複雑です。公式にはMac専用ですが、ハックは存在します。面倒な思いをしないためにも、公式または信頼できるソースからダウンロードするようにしてください。ダウンロードしたら、ISOイメージを見つけやすい場所に保存します。私は通常、 のようなフォルダを作成しますC:\ISOimages

新しい仮想マシンをセットアップする

選択したVMソフトウェアを起動します。VirtualBoxの場合は、「新規」ボタンを押し、VMに名前(「Test Linux」や「Old Windows」など)を付け、OSの種類(LinuxまたはWindowsなど)を選択し、RAMを割り当てます。軽量Linuxの場合は少なくとも2~4GB、余裕があればそれ以上の容量を確保してください。仮想ハードドライブ(VHDまたはVDI)を作成します。基本的な用途であれば20~50GB程度が適切です。VMwareの場合も同様の手順で、新しいVMを作成し、ウィザードに従って操作します。リソースは実際のハードウェアが処理できる容量に基づいて割り当てることを忘れないでください。RAMが8GBしかないのに、デフォルトで16GBに設定してはいけません。

ISOをマウントしてインストールを開始する

ここから魔法が始まります。VM設定で、ドライブまたは光学ディスクのセクションを見つけ、ダウンロードしたISOファイルをマウントします。VirtualBoxの場合は「ストレージ」タブにあります。空の光学ドライブをクリックし、「ディスクファイルを選択」を選択してISOファイルを選択します。次に、VMを起動します。実際のコンピュータと同じように、ISOファイルから自動的に起動し、OSのインストールを促すメッセージが表示されます。画面の指示に従い、言語とパーティション(ほとんどのVMは空です)を選択して、あとはVMに任せましょう。起動時に問題が発生した場合は、VM設定で起動順序を確認してください。仮想DVDドライブが優先されるはずです。

Guest Additions または VMware Tools をインストールする

この手順は省略されがちですが、大きな違いを生みます。OSをインストールしたら、ゲストツールを探してください。VirtualBoxの場合は、「デバイス」>「Guest Additions CDイメージの挿入」、VMwareの場合は「VM」>「VMware Toolsのインストール」です。これらのツールはパフォーマンスを向上させ、グラフィックを向上し、ホストとゲスト間でファイルを簡単にドラッグアンドドロップできるようにします。場合によっては、ISOをマウントしてVM内でインストーラーを実行するだけで済むこともあります。これらのツールがないと、特にマウスと画面解像度のサポートがないとVMの実行がかなり遅くなるので、試してみる価値はあります。

これで完了です!これでWindows 11環境内にOSが構築され、テストを実行したり、探索したり、ただ触ったりする準備が整いました。メインOSに影響を与えることなく、いつでもVMをシャットダウン、スナップショット作成、起動できます。なぜこんなにスムーズに動作するのかはよく分かりませんが、セットアップしてしまえば本当にスムーズです。

仮想化エクスペリエンスを向上させるためのヒント

  • ハードウェアが仮想化をサポートしていることを確認します (BIOS/UEFI で Intel VT-x または AMD-V を確認し、オンにします)。
  • 安全を保つために、信頼できるソースから ISO ファイルをダウンロードしてください。
  • システムの処理能力に応じて VM 設定で RAM と CPU コアを調整します。やりすぎないようにしてください。
  • 大きな変更や OS のインストールの前に、スナップショットを使用して VM の状態を保存します。
  • 仮想化ソフトウェアを最新の状態に保ってください。修正やパフォーマンスの向上が頻繁に行われます。

よくある質問

VirtualBox と VMware の違いは何ですか?

VirtualBoxは無料、オープンソースで、基本的な用途に最適です。VMwareはより洗練されており、USBやスナップショットのサポートも優れていますが、VMware Workstationを使用するには費用がかかります。ほとんどの一般ユーザーにとって、VirtualBoxで十分でしょう。

Windows 上の VM で macOS を実行できますか?

法的には、AppleのライセンスによりmacOSはMacハードウェアのみでの使用に制限されています。しかし、技術的には、ハックを使ってmacOSで動作させている人もいますが、複雑でサポートもされていません。グレーゾーンであり、公式にはサポートされていないことにご注意ください。

超高性能な PC が必要ですか?

RAM、CPUコア数、ストレージ速度(SSDなど)が速いほど、よりスムーズな操作性が得られます。ミッドレンジPCでも問題なくVMを実行できますが、VMを過剰に実行したり、すべてのリソースをVMに割り当てたりするのは避けましょう。Windowsにもある程度のパワーが必要です。

まとめ

  • 仮想化アプリ (VirtualBox、VMware、Hyper-V) を選択します。
  • 信頼できるソースから対象 OS の ISO をダウンロードします。
  • 仮想マシンを作成して構成し、RAM、ディスク領域などを割り当てます。
  • ISO をマウントし、VM を起動して、インストール プロンプトに従います。
  • パフォーマンスと使いやすさを向上させるためにゲスト ツールをインストールします。

まとめ

Windows 11内で別のOSを動かすのは、一度コツをつかむとかなりハマります。デュアルブートやパーティション設定をいじるよりもはるかに安全です。好奇心旺盛な方、ソフトウェアのテストをしたい方、あるいはメインの環境を壊さずに他のOSの動作を確認したい方に最適です。ただし、ハードウェアはそれなりの性能が必要で、ライセンスとセキュリティにも気を配ることを忘れないでください。この方法が役に立つことを願っています。私の場合は、Linuxディストリビューションと古いバージョンのWindowsをテストするのに問題なく使えました。